We re seeking someone to join our team as an Associate in Market Risk Team In the Firm Risk Management division, we advise businesses across the Firm on risk mitigation strategies, develop tools to analyse and monitor risks and lead key regulatory initiatives. What you ll do in the role: Support independent testing verification of algorithms, controls, and associated risk frameworks, ensuring alignment with firm policies and regulatory expectations Assist in identifying control gaps, weaknesses, and emerging risks through structured validation and testing processes Execute algorithm testing verification, scenario validation, and control effectiveness assessments in a timely and controlled manner Develop and maintain high-quality documentation, testing review evidence, and audit trails aligned with governance standards Collaborate with Trading desks, Technology, Compliance, and other Risk teams to support validation of algos and control enhancements Contribute to global and regional initiatives aimed at strengthening testing frameworks, analytics capabilities, and risk oversight processes Support continuous improvement and automation of testing verification, tools, and processes within the ATV function Assist in responding to ad-hoc queries and supporting regulatory and audit-related requests What you ll bring to the role: 4 - 7 years of experience in electronic trading, risk management, quantitative analytics, or related domains Bachelors degree in Engineering, Finance, Mathematics, Computer Science, or a related quantitative discipline Strong understanding of risk management concepts and control frameworks, with awareness of second line of defense responsibilities Strong analytical and problem-solving skills with the ability to interpret complex datasets and derive meaningful insights Proficiency in Python, SQL, Excel, or similar tools for data analysis and testing Understanding of algorithmic trading concepts, market microstructure, or electronic trading workflows is beneficial Exposure to testing frameworks, model validation, or control assurance processes is a plus Familiarity with FIX messaging, market data, or trading systems is advantageous Ability to manage multiple deliverables with strong ownership, attention to detail, and focus on quality and timelines Strong interpersonal skills and ability to work effectively in a global, cross-functional environment Strong verbal and written communication skills with the ability to present information clearly and concisely Self-driven, proactive, and highly organized with the ability to operate effectively in a fast-paced environment Disclaimer : This job posting has been aggregated from external source.
